Transaction d3675dad6ce8793542428209e7ebb68415af937f476aedd72b191fc6efd02dda
1 Input
1 Output
-
d3675dad6ce8793542428209e7ebb68415af937f476aedd72b191fc6efd02dda:0
- value
- 5996997
- script pubkey
- OP_0 OP_PUSHBYTES_20 a4ddaa3a04c8b86fb4113802a6cb651b012f26f9
- address
- bc1q5nw65wsyezuxldq38qp2djm9rvqj7fhepv5mrh